“Freaks!”

Wild Dog takes center stage on this Barry Crain and Rick Magyar cover, bursting through a doorway in his hockey-mask and blue jersey, dual submachine guns blazing, while a chaotic pack of dogs of every breed surges around him — dobermans, bulldogs, chow chows, and more spilling across the composition with gleeful energy. The cover tagline "Breaks Loose!" says it all, and the anarchic charm of this image makes it one of the more memorable entries in DC's ambitious 48-pages-every-week anthology format. Inside, Wild Dog's "Freaks!" story shares the stage with Superman, Black Canary, Green Lantern, Nightwing, and Blackhawk — a genuinely impressive lineup for a single issue.
